Description:
Glycylthreonine is a dipeptide composed of the amino acids glycine and threonine, linked by a peptide bond. It is represented by the chemical formula C6H12N2O5 and has a molecular weight that reflects its composition of carbon, hydrogen, nitrogen, and oxygen atoms. Glycylthreonine is characterized by its role in biological systems, particularly in protein synthesis and metabolism. It exhibits properties typical of peptides, such as solubility in water and the ability to form hydrogen bonds, which contribute to its stability and functionality in physiological conditions. The presence of the threonine residue imparts additional characteristics, such as potential phosphorylation sites, which can influence its biological activity. Glycylthreonine may also have applications in nutritional supplements and research, particularly in studies related to protein structure and function. As with many peptides, its stability can be affected by factors such as pH and temperature, making it important to consider these conditions in experimental settings.
